Understanding BPC-157: A Promising Experimental Peptide

BPC-157, also often referred to as Body Protection Compound 157, is a pentadecapeptide that has garnered significant attention for its purported regenerative and healing properties. It is a synthetic peptide derived from a protein found in human gastric juiceGastric PentadecapeptideBPC-157is a synthetic fifteen amino acid oligopeptide derived from a protein found in human gastric juice. BPC-157 has been .... Researchers have investigated BPC-157 for its ability to promote healing across various tissues and conditionsMultifunctionality and Possible Medical Application of the .... Studies, particularly in animal models, have indicated high efficacy in rats suffering from toxic or surgical trauma.

It's crucial to note that BPC-157 is an experimental compound and is not approved for human clinical use by regulatory bodies. This lack of approval means that its production is unregulated, and there is a potential for negative health effectsBPC-157. Scientific Contexts Involving "156" and Peptides

Beyond the prominent BPC-157, the number "156" appears in other scientific contexts related to peptides, often within the realm of molecular biology and immunology:

* HLA-B*35 and Peptide Binding: Research has explored the impact of polymorphisms at residue 156 of certain human leukocyte antigen (HLA) molecules, such as HLA-B*35. Specifically, the polymorphism at residue 156 can modulate peptide binding, peptide conformation, and peptide flexibility. For example, studies have shown that the single mismatch at AA156 can modulate these interactions. The amino acid residue 156 is often located at a critical position, such as the center of the α2 helix, which contacts the antigen peptide.
